Ordinals
beta
Sat 1589265156554113
decimal
431412.156554113
degree
0°11412′2004″156554113‴
percentile
40.332705994179165%
name
ppzrjqtoqku
cycle
0
epoch
2
period
213
block
431412
offset
156554113
timestamp
2016-09-25 07:55:06 UTC
rarity
common
prev
next